The sounds of (almost) silence – hearing the heartbeat of a snail

Thomas Edison (or his students, one really never knows with him) worked on the carbon microphone in 1876.   Since then, microphone technology has come a heck of a long way, from liquid microphones that rendered speech so you could actually understand it (early mics couldn’t render speech intelligibly), to condenser mics used for studio recordings and scientific recordings.

The Beer Organ.  Audio included!

This one ranks right up there with the weirder musical instruments.  The Beer Organ is a keyboard device that actuates compressed air which blows over the openings of beer bottles.
